Data Analysis Expressions (DAX)

Was verbirgt sich hinter DAX (Data Analysis Expressions)?

DAX – kurz für Data Analysis Expressions – ist die leistungsstarke Formelsprache von Microsoft, die speziell für die Analyse und Modellierung von Daten in Power BI, Power Pivot und SSAS Tabular entwickelt wurde.

Sie ermöglicht es, komplexe Berechnungen durchzuführen und damit präzise Einblicke aus großen Datenmengen zu gewinnen. Durch DAX lassen sich Daten filtern, aggregieren, logisch verknüpfen und analysieren – ein echtes Multitalent für datengetriebene Entscheidungen.

Ein großer Vorteil: Die Syntax von DAX orientiert sich stark an bekannten Excel-Formeln. Das macht den Einstieg für viele Nutzer*innen besonders leicht – selbst bei anspruchsvollen Analyse-Szenarien. Gleichzeitig geht DAX deutlich über die Möglichkeiten von Excel hinaus, insbesondere bei der Arbeit mit großen Datenmodellen oder beim Aufbau interaktiver Dashboards in Power BI.

Mit DAX lassen sich sogenannte berechnete Spalten und Measures definieren. Diese ermöglichen es, dynamische KPIs oder benutzerdefinierte Metriken direkt im Datenmodell zu erstellen – ganz ohne externe Datenquellen oder manuelle Zwischenschritte.

Ein weiteres Plus: DAX unterstützt die Definition von Beziehungen zwischen Tabellen, wodurch auch komplexe Datenmodelle mit mehreren Quellen effizient analysiert werden können. Dank der tiefen Integration in Microsofts BI-Tools sind Echtzeit-Auswertungen problemlos möglich – ein entscheidender Vorteil für alle, die mit aktuellen Daten arbeiten wollen.

Doch DAX überzeugt nicht nur durch seine Funktionalität, sondern auch durch seine Skalierbarkeit und Sicherheit. So lassen sich benutzerbezogene Zugriffsrechte auf Spaltenebene definieren – ein wichtiges Feature für Unternehmen, die mit sensiblen Daten arbeiten.

Typische Einsatzgebiete von DAX

Die Ausdruckssprache DAX entfaltet ihr volles Potenzial vor allem in den modernen Business-Intelligence-Lösungen von Microsoft – und genau dort kommt sie in verschiedensten Szenarien zum Einsatz.

In Power BI etwa bildet DAX die Grundlage für Berechnungen, individuelle Kennzahlen und dynamische Visualisierungen. Mit DAX lassen sich interaktive Dashboards erstellen, die Geschäftsprozesse verständlich abbilden und jederzeit fundierte Entscheidungen ermöglichen.

Ein weiteres wichtiges Einsatzfeld ist SQL Server Analysis Services (SSAS) Tabular. Hier dient DAX dazu, unternehmensweite Datenmodelle zu gestalten, die skalierbar sind und zentral verwaltet werden. Das macht DAX zur idealen Wahl für alle, die auf konsistente und nachvollziehbare Analysen im gesamten Unternehmen setzen.

Auch in Power Query findet DAX Anwendung – insbesondere bei der Transformation, Bereinigung und Verknüpfung von Daten vor deren Verwendung in Power BI oder Power Pivot. So lassen sich bereits im Vorfeld wichtige Schritte der Datenaufbereitung automatisieren und vereinheitlichen.

Selbst in Power Automate, Microsofts Lösung für Prozessautomatisierung, spielt DAX eine Rolle: Hier unterstützt es datenbasierte Entscheidungen, etwa bei der Berechnung von Schwellenwerten oder der Steuerung automatisierter Abläufe auf Basis von Datenwerten.

DAX ist somit weit mehr als nur eine Formelsprache – es ist ein zentrales Werkzeug, um Daten effizient und zielgerichtet zu analysieren. Durch ihre Nähe zur Excel-Syntax ist DAX leicht zugänglich und ermöglicht auch Nicht-Programmierern den Einstieg in fortgeschrittene Datenanalysen.